ABOUT THE DIRECTOR

Born in Athens in 1955, he studied mathematics at Athens University and film at the Stavrakou Film School. From 1976 until 1992 he has worked as an assistant director with many filmmakers, most notably with Pantelis Voulgaris. He has taught in the Film Department at the Aristotle University of Thessaloniki since the department was founded in 2004. He was appointed Assistant Professor of Film Direction in November 2008. 
In 2011, he wrote and directed a 13-episode documentary series, “I Met Happy Craftsmen,” which broadcasted on the Greek Television channel ET1. His films have distinguished themselves at festivals internationally.

A NOTE FROM THE DIRECTOR

I wanted to talk about my experience of teaching ‘Direction’ for 19 years in the Aristotle University of Thessaloniki Film School. About the joy I felt when a lesson went well, our hopes of building one of the finest film schools in Europe, the enormous problems we encountered. About cinema. Specifically, about teaching cinema, and how film transforms the illusion into emotion. “It’s all a lie”, Nikos says during an exercise, “but our emotions, they’re real”. About three generations: those of Mr Andrikos, the students —the gap between the two is vast— and Nikos in the middle, trying to pass his passion on to the young filmmakers. Finally, I wanted to talk about a son who seeks his father’s approval after many, many years.

The city and the city | Η πόλη κι η πόλη (2021) by Christos Passalis and Syllas Tzoumerkas

 

On Tuesday 15 November at 19:00 and on Wednesday 16 November at 21:00 the film THE CITY AND THE CITY (Greece, 2021, 87 min, colour & black and white) directed by Christos Passalis and Syllas Tzoumerkas will be screened in cinema Utopia, in the original version (Greek and other languages) with English subtitles. The film is suitable for children over 12.

Synopsis


The untold story of the life and perils of the Jewish community of Thessaloniki, in six chapters. The past and the present of a city, meet and converge at its cracks. Unlike most films about the Holocaust, The City and the City does not record episodes from the Nazi concentration camps, but instead focuses on the geography of memory. In this film, memory is omnipresent in the geography of a modern city because it refers not to the past, but to the present and the future. That is why the form of the film is unexpected and unclassifiable, like the memory of its two filmmakers, who return to Thessaloniki, their birthplace, and offer to guide us into the abyss.

A few words about the directors


Christos Passalis was born in Thessaloniki, Greece in 1978. As an actor he participated in Yorgos Lanthimos’ Dogtooth (2009), Syllas Tzoumerkas’ Homeland (2010) and The Miracle of the Sargasso Sea (2019), Vardis Marinakis’ Black Field (2010) and Fiona Tan’s History’s Future (2014). In theatre, he co-founded the blitz theatre group (2004-2019), writing, directing and acting in all the group’s performances (Théâtre de la Ville, the Schaubühne, the Festival d’ Avignon, and various other major theatres and theatre festivals around the world). Since 2019, he co-directs with Angeliki Papoulia at the Luzerner theater in Switzerland, and other venues. His upcoming feature film, Silence 6-9, is currently in post-production.


Syllas Tzoumerkas was born in Thessaloniki, Greece in 1978. His feature debut, Homeland, had its world premiere at the Venice Critics’ Week (2010). His sophomore, A Blast, premiered in competition at the Locarno International Film Festival (2014) and his third, The Miracle of the Sargasso Sea, at the Berlinale Panorama (2019). Internationally acclaimed for their distinctive style, bold characterization and strong performances, Tzoumerkas’ films have participated in over 200 festivals around the world and have been distributed to theatres and streaming platforms in many countries. Apart from his theatrical and multi-platform works, he co-wrote the scripts of Argyris Papadimitropoulos’ feature Suntan (2016), and Ahmed Ghossein’s All This Victory (2019). He co-curates with fellow director Elina Psykou, Motherland, I See You, the moving festival and restoration program of the Hellenic Film Academy.

Smyrna | Σμύρνη μου αγαπημένη (2021) by Grigoris Karantinakis



On Tuesday 27 September at 19:00 and on Wednesday 28 September at 21:00 the film SMYRNA (Greece, 2021, 141 min, colour, period drama) directed by Grigoris Karantinakis will be screened in cinema Utopia, in the Greek original version with English subtitles. The film is suitable for children over 16.

Synopsis


This moving drama recounts the1922 burning of the cosmopolitan city of Smyrna and the assault on its vibrant and prosperous Greek and Armenian communities. The historical incidents and facts that preceded and occurred during the occupation of Smyrna in 1922 by the Turkish army, including the massacre of the local Greek and Armenian population, are recounted through the lives of the Baltatzis family members.

Motherland, I see you (panorama of the 20th century Greek cinema) | Χώρα, σε βλέπω (πανόραμα του ελληνικού κινηματογράφου του 20ού αιώνα)


21/03 - 13/4/2022


The Ciné-club hellénique de Luxembourg presents a small panorama of the 20th century Greek cinema with 6 short and 13 full length films selected from the programme proposed by the initiative Motherland, I see you. 

This initiative of the Hellenic Film Academy, under the Auspices of the “Greece 2021” Committee, sponsored by the National Centre of Audiovisual Media & Communication (grand sponsor), the Greek Film Centre, the Athens Epidaurus Festival and the Thessaloniki International Film Festival, and with the support of the Greek Film Archive and Finos Film, is dedicated to salvaging, preserving and screening films from the diverse Greek heritage of the 20th Century, in the context of the 200-year anniversary from the Greek Revolution against the Ottoman Empire in 1821.

All films are digitally restored and they will be presented in their original version with English subtitles.
